Subject: Loading dock hours — night shift please read

Hi all,

A reminder from the front desk at Pellam Tower: the loading dock on Warrick Street accepts deliveries only between 22:00 and 05:30 on weeknights. Any courier arriving outside that window must be turned away politely and logged in the dock diary. Please keep the roller shutter closed between arrivals, as heat escapes quickly. The dock personnel door is on a keypad; use the code below.

Thanks,
Front Desk

door code, bafop-kafof: bdg-EVGJYW-26961323

**Ticket: Firmware channel drift on Copperlane fleet**

Devices in the Hallowfen test pool are pulling firmware from the beta channel while provisioning templates still specify stable. Drift introduced by a manual override during last month's hotfix; never reverted. Future maintainers: always revert channel overrides after emergency pushes. Reconcile before next rollout. The current channel configuration on the drifted devices is as follows.

deployment values, yadup-kadug:
[sorys]
port = 5672
team = noveth
host = sorys.orvexcorp.example
region = south-4
access_code = ac_deddc1
timeout_ms = 1500

## Wiki role sync — quick note for release cuts

Before tagging a release of Pagefern, double-check that the role-based access mapper can reach the wiki's admin API. If editors suddenly can't see the release-notes space, it's almost always because the sync job lost its credential after the quarterly rotation. Don't hand-edit roles in the UI; the mapper will just overwrite them on the next run. Instead, update the env file on the sync host with the following line.

sealed setting: ARCHIVE_KEY3=8d0

To: Incoming Director, Branch Operations
From: Outgoing Director, Marlen Deverro

Branch managers have been briefed on the revised pricing for the Brightline cookware range. Margins were lifted to 34% in urban branches; rural branches stay at 29% through the next quarter. Discount authority remains capped at 10% without regional sign-off. Competitor moves from Ostavi Homewares should be monitored monthly. Pricing reviews happen each quarter, no exceptions. The confidential strategic note for your eyes is appended below.

board note of kageg-bahof: The renewal with Holwynax Holdings closes at $2 million a year, 5 percent below the last contract. Project Ulaath slips by two quarters because of the supplier delay.